Manually mapping hundreds of fields and values can be extremely laborious and prone to error.

Mapping suggestion algorithms offer machine assistance to manually selected mappings.

The algorithms work by starting with a context provided by the application, and via a series of iterations, narrow down the options to a small number. The algorithms are further tuned for specific patterns found in some source fields and values, and perhaps some authoring conventions when the target concepts were created.
